Crypto Market Sees Faint Recovery Signs Amid Mixed ETF Flows
The cryptocurrency market shows faint signs of recovery after days of decline, led by Bitcoin's (BTC) rise to $78,000. Ethereum (ETH) and XRP have also trended higher above $2,400 and $1.37 respectively.
The uptick in prices comes despite mixed ETF flows, with Bitcoin attracting inflows totaling $101 million on Wednesday, while Ethereum and XRP saw outflows of $48 million and $7 billion respectively.
Despite this, market sentiment remains relatively elevated, reflected in the Fear & Greed Index, which rose to 65 in the Greed territory on Thursday.
Technical analysis suggests that Bitcoin's rebound is supported by its near-term bias and momentum, with immediate support at the current pivot zone around $78,000. Ethereum's price also consolidates well above its short-, medium- and long-term EMAs, while XRP holds above major moving averages.
